ホームページ > バックエンド開発 > PHPチュートリアル > php は Cookie を設定および読み取ります

php は Cookie を設定および読み取ります

WBOY
リリース: 2016-06-23 13:40:58
オリジナル
1218 人が閲覧しました


概念的な理解:

Cookie はサーバーによって生成され、ユーザー エージェント (通常はブラウザ) に送信され、ブラウザは Cookie のキー/値を特定のディレクトリ内のテキスト ファイルに保存します。内部では、次回同じ Web サイトがリクエストされたときに Cookie がサーバーに送信されます (ブラウザーが Cookie を有効にするように設定されている場合)。

setcookie(name,value,expire,path,domain,secure)
ログイン後にコピー


php set cookie

a. キーと値:

setcookie("name",'zhangshan');
ログイン後にコピー


b. タイムアウトを設定します:

setcookie("name",'zhangshan',time()+10);
ログイン後にコピー


c. パスを設定します

setcookie("name",'zhangshan',time()+10,'/');
ログイン後にコピー


d. アクセスドメインを設定します

 setcookie("name",'zhangshan',time()+10,'mi.com');
ログイン後にコピー

d.セキュリティアクセス値を0または1に設定します


注: Cookie は文字列と数値のみを保存できます。 IE['名前']または$ http_cookie_vars [' name ']読み取り



クッキーが次のように複数の値を設定できないことを読み取ります。配列をシリアル化して変数に保存できます

   setcookie("name",'zhangshan');   setcookie("age",15);
ログイン後にコピー


php delete cookie

$arr = array(1,2,3);  $arr_str = serialize($arr);    setcookie("name",$arr_str);  
ログイン後にコピー

りー




関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ート